Shakespeare was affected by the Latin authors he was obliged to read at school: Ovid, Plutarch and the like, and he refers to stories from these books frequently. He was also familiar with contemporary Italian fiction. He mined Holinshead's Chronicles (a history book) for the stories based on British history. He was aware of what was going on in the theatre community of which he was a part, so he knew what other playwrights were doing, and he was demonstrably affected by theatrical trends. Did any of this make him a good author? No, not really. His abilities with words, his comprehension of human nature and problems, his ability to tell a story dramatically were what made him great, and he did not get them from any other author.
